MasterCard announced generally very positive earnings yesterday. In their call, there was more depth of conversation around the news revealed earlier in April that China would be opening up its payment infrastructure to foreign payment networks. This could have a significant impact on MasterCard debit card volume as the China market is much more debit-centric, however there were many points made to suggest that we keep the excitement in check; The process of gaining access, negotiating licensing with the government and establishing “on-soil” operations will not happen overnight. Although the debit market is very large, it will require concerted effort to make it as attractive a market as other geographies. Most debit cards in China are dormant, and for those cards in use, the most frequent card transaction is to get cash out of ATMS not or POS purchases
